Rearview camera image may not display/fmvss 111
Defect Summary
Toyota motor engineering & manufacturing (toyota) is recalling certain 2024-2025 toyota tundra and tundra hybrid vehicles equipped with a panoramic view monitor (pvm) system. The rearview camera image may not display when the vehicle is placed in reverse.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of federal motor vehicle safety standard (fmvss) number 111, "rear visibility."
Safety Consequence
A rearview camera image that does not display reduces the driver's view behind the vehicle, increasing the risk of a crash.
Corrective Action
Dealers will update the parking assist ecu software,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ed march 23, 2026. Owners may contact toyota's customer service at 1-800-331-4331. Toyota's numbers for this recall are 26tb02 and 26ta02.

What is recall 26V038000?
NHTSA recall 26V038000 was issued by Toyota Motor Engineering & Manufacturing on January 23, 2026. It addresses: Rearview camera image may not display/fmvss 111. The recall affects approximately 161,268 vehicles, with the defect involving the Back Over Prevention component.

How long do I have to get a recall repair done?
There is no expiration on most federal safety recalls. Even if your vehicle is years old and you bought it used, the manufacturer is required to perform the repair at no cost.
